Improving Public Health Standards

A collaborative water purification program spanning three sub-counties has achieved significant progress in clean water access. By installing solar-powered sanitization systems, local dispensaries have observed a sharp drop in typhoid cases.

Health officers have encouraged rural households to continue practicing standard hygiene protocols to consolidate these gains.
